Ons Jabeur introduced the start of her first little one on Monday, sharing the information in a transient social media post.
The former world No. 2 has been away from competitors in latest months attributable to plans to begin a household, pausing what has been one of essentially the most constant careers on the WTA Tour.

Messages of congratulations rapidly adopted on Instagram from fellow gamers, together with Paula Badosa, Belinda Bencic, Naomi Osaka and Billie Jean King. “Can’t wait to meet him,” wrote Badosa. While Osaka stated: “Omg congratulations”.
Jabeur first introduced her being pregnant in November after stepping away from competitors, having final appeared at Wimbledonin July, the place she retired within the opening spherical. “Took a little break to reset and recharge… Turns out, we’ve been planning the cutest comeback ever,” Jabeur wrote on the time. “The court will have to wait a little longer, because soon we’ll be welcoming our tiniest teammate.”
Since turning skilled in 2010, Ons Jabeur has reached three Grand Slam finals—on the 2022 US Open and at Wimbledon in 2022 and 2023—changing into the highest-ranked Arab and African participant in historical past.
Her latest absence from the tour adopted a stretch of accidents and uneven outcomes via 2024 and 2025. The break has since prolonged into maternity go away, ruling her out of the present clay-court swing and leaving her on the sidelines during the season’s early European buildup.
The three-time Grand Slam finalist has remained carefully linked to tennis during her maternity go away, launching a YouTube collection that features an interview with fellow former world No. 2 Badosa.
In latest years, the WTA—with robust enter from its Player Council—has pushed a collection of reforms geared toward making the tour more supportive for moms competing on the circuit. Under the up to date insurance policies, eligible gamers can now retain a protected rating whereas stepping away for maternity go away or fertility therapy.
They are additionally entitled to paid maternity go away of up to 12 months, alongside financial assist for fertility preservation procedures via the Maternity Fund Programme, developed by the WTA in partnership with Saudi Arabia’s Public Investment Fund (PIF). “The maternity programme is unbelievable and I want to thank PIF and WTA for making this happen,” Jabeur informed The National in November
Jabeur spoke in a March interview with Vogue Arabia, expressing her intention to return to competitors and stating she hopes to “compete for a couple more years” earlier than ultimately stepping away from the game. “I want to give myself the time to see how my body will react” she stated. “I want him to be creative, to make jokes,” she added of her hopes for her son. “Most important is that he’s a good person and makes a change in the world.”
